Yongjia Pumped Storage Power Station Project – Wenzhou, Zhejiang
Release time:
2025-09-29 09:57
Project Overview
-
Project Name: China Power Construction Bureau 5 – Yongjia Pumped Storage Power Station, Baiqiao Line, Zhang’ao Village, Yongjia County, Wenzhou, Zhejiang Province
-
Project Type: Hydropower (Pumped Storage Power Station)
-
Location: Wenzhou, Zhejiang Province, China
-
Testing Equipment: RSM-SY6(C) Ultrasonic Rock Mass Tester
Testing Purpose & Method
The testing was conducted as part of third-party quality inspection and safety evaluation of underground structures at the pumped storage power station. The ultrasonic wave velocity method was used to determine the loosening zone of surrounding rock, a key parameter for assessing stability after blasting excavation.
Testing Scope
-
Determination of loosening zones around underground caverns and tunnels
-
Quality acceptance and verification of construction blasting impact
-
Structural safety evaluation of surrounding rock
Testing Results
-
Findings: Ultrasonic wave velocity data indicated that the surrounding rock mass remained intact.
-
Impact: No cracks or significant stress reduction were detected, confirming that blasting operations did not adversely affect nearby rock stability.
Evaluation
-
Engineering Evaluation: The surrounding rock stability met design expectations, supporting both safety and quality acceptance of the hydropower project.
